Subject: [PATCH v1 5/7] drm/xe/vf: Rebase HWSP of all contexts after migration
Date: Wed, 14 May 2025 00:49:50 +0200	[thread overview]
Message-ID: <20250513224952.701343-6-tomasz.lis@intel.com> (raw)
In-Reply-To: <20250513224952.701343-1-tomasz.lis@intel.com>

All contexts require an update due to GGTT range shift, as that
affects their HWSP.

The HW status page of a context contains GGTT references, which
need to be shifted to a new range (or re-computed using the
previously updated vma nodes). The references include ring start
address and indirect state address.

+/**
+ * xe_lrc_update_hwctx_regs_with_address - Re-compute GGTT references within given LRC.
+ * @lrc: the &xe_lrc struct instance
+ */
+void xe_lrc_update_hwctx_regs_with_address(struct xe_lrc *lrc)
+{
+	struct xe_gt *gt = lrc->fence_ctx.gt;
+
+	if (xe_gt_has_indirect_ring_state(gt)) {
+		xe_lrc_write_ctx_reg(lrc, CTX_INDIRECT_RING_STATE,
+				     __xe_lrc_indirect_ring_ggtt_addr(lrc));
+
+		xe_lrc_write_indirect_ctx_reg(lrc, INDIRECT_CTX_RING_START,
+					      __xe_lrc_ring_ggtt_addr(lrc));
+	} else
+		xe_lrc_write_ctx_reg(lrc, CTX_RING_START, __xe_lrc_ring_ggtt_addr(lrc));
+}

+static void xe_exec_queue_contexts_hwsp_rebase(struct xe_exec_queue *eq)
+{
+	int i;
+
+	for (i = 0; i < eq->width; ++i)
+		xe_lrc_update_hwctx_regs_with_address(eq->lrc[i]);
+}
+
+static void xe_guc_contexts_hwsp_rebase(struct xe_guc *guc)
+{
+	struct xe_exec_queue *eq;
+	unsigned long index;
+
+	mutex_lock(&guc->submission_state.lock);
+	xa_for_each(&guc->submission_state.exec_queue_lookup, index, eq)
+		xe_exec_queue_contexts_hwsp_rebase(eq);
+	mutex_unlock(&guc->submission_state.lock);
+}
+
+static void vf_post_migration_fixup_contexts(struct xe_device *xe)
+{
+	struct xe_gt *gt;
+	unsigned int id;
+
+	for_each_gt(gt, xe, id)
+		xe_guc_contexts_hwsp_rebase(&gt->uc.guc);
+}
